We need more info:

* Verify exactly which DLCs are working and which are not. Do they show in the launcher?
* What OS are you using?
* Check your DLC installation folder (normally "Program Files/steam/steamapps/common/Crusader Kings II/DLC"). Do you have files there called dlc007.dlc, dlc007.zip (Sword of Islam)?
* If not, check the same in the folder "My Documents/Paradox Interactive/Crusader Kings II/DLC".
* Are you using a custom 'userdir'?

Also, please give us your logs (under "My Documents/Paradox Interactive/Crusader Kings II/logs")
 
As Doomdark says; we'll need more info.

We've tried to reproduce this with our QA steam accounts; with Ruler designer, Sword of Islam and Legacy of Rome installed, all three work just fine.

one thing you might try, beyond the information Doomdark mentions; try removing or renaming the dlc_signature file (in "My Documents/Paradox Interactive/Crusader Kings II"), see if it recreated correctly.
